DeVon Franklin lately joined The Morning Hustle to debate his newest movie, his dynamic profession, and his private journey of development and love. The producer, creator, and motivational speaker shared highly effective insights, providing an inspiring look into his world.
A significant spotlight of the dialog was his new Netflix film, Ruth & Boaz, a contemporary retelling of the biblical love story. Franklin defined his motivation for the movie, noting the shortage of nice love tales centered on individuals of shade lately. He needed to convey a narrative of chivalry, service, and genuine like to the display. The movie is the primary of a three-picture, faith-based take care of Netflix, created in a strong partnership with Tyler Perry. Franklin described Perry not simply as a companion however as a mentor, evaluating him to Mr. Miyagi. Perry inspired him to take full authority over the undertaking, making a supportive atmosphere that allowed Franklin’s imaginative and prescient to shine.

The casting was a key component, with Serayah and Tyler Lepley bringing a novel chemistry to the lead roles, and the legendary Phylicia Rashad enjoying Naomi. Franklin shared how Rashad’s presence elevated your entire set, reminding everybody of her iconic standing. The soundtrack, that includes a brand new music from Babyface and even a prayer monitor from Franklin himself, is now out there for streaming.
On a private notice, Franklin opened up about his personal journey with love and relationships. He spoke concerning the significance of “doing the work” on your self first, which makes the work in a relationship extra manageable and fulfilling. He emphasised that non-public development comes from processing your emotions via remedy, prayer, or journaling. Franklin shared that his personal evolving love life paralleled the event of the Ruth & Boaz script, permitting him to pour his genuine experiences into the movie. His reflections on compassion and permitting individuals the grace to navigate their very own journeys resonated deeply, offering a message of hope and understanding for all.
